Is Charlton Village and Riverside Safe?
Charlton Village and Riverside has a safety score of 7/100, placing it in the bottom 7% of UK neighbourhoods. In January 2026, police recorded 434 crimes in this area, including 142 violent offences.
This area has higher crime rates than most UK neighbourhoods. Take extra precautions with personal belongings and avoid walking alone at night.
